Ailyn Perez, Tamara Wilson & Emily D’Angelo Headline Santa Fe Opera’s 2020 Season

By Francisco Salazar

The Santa Fe Opera has announced its highly anticipated 2020 season featuring a number of unique new productions, role debuts, and one world premiere.

Emily D’Angelo, Jack Swanson, and Audun Iverson highlight Rossini’s “Il Barbiere di Siviglia” with Corrado Rovaris conducting. Scott Conner and Kevin Burdette round out the cast.

Performance Dates: July 3-August 29, 2020

Eric Ferring. Joelle Harvey, Audrey Luna, Joshua Hopkins, and James Creswell star in Mozart’s “The Magic Flute” with Harry Bicket conducting Tim Albery’s production.

Performance Dates: July 4-August 28, 2020

Tamara Wilson and Simon O’Neill star in Wagner’s “Tristan und Isolde” with Ryan McKinney, Eric Owens, and David Leigh. James Gaffigan conducts the production by Zack Winokur.

Performance Dates: July18-August 18, 2020

Ailyn Perez makes her role debut in Dvorak’s “Rusalka” with Eric Cutler, James Creswell, Michaela Martens, and Alexandra Lobianco. Harry Bicket conducts David Pountney’s production.

Performance Dates: July 25-August 27, 2020

Huang Ruo and David Henry Hwang’s “M. Butterfly” gets its world premiere with a cast that includes Hera Hyesang Park, David Bizic, Kangmin Justin Kim, Kevin Burdette, and Joshua Dennis. Xian XZhang conducts the work with James Robinson directing the production.

Performance Dates: August 1-26, 2020

The season concludes with “Apprentice Scenes” which are fully-staged scenes from the operatic repertory showcasing the remarkable talent of Santa Fe Opera Apprentice Singers and Technicians.

Performance Dates: August 16 & 23, 2020
